Drive a Nissan Leaf to San Francisco. Want to charge it for the return trip to Sacramento. Better not be in a hurry. A full charge could take eight hours. But there is a new charger on the way that is going to change that. The fast chargers can do the job in around twenty minutes.
HELSEL "What is really great is as these fast charging units
proliferate, it means that your going to have a lot more mobility
with your electric vehicle."
Kristen Helsel is vice president of California based
AeroVironment, which helped design the charger. It has a price tag
of around 9,900 dollars. The first chargers are being tested in
Houston and should be available in the California market in early
2012.
